In this thread, I'd like to prove to you that what Israel is doing in Gaza is premeditated slaughter that preceded October 7 by decades.

I will use quotes from zionist colonizers themselves.

1. Calls to ensure the total subjugation, decimation, and humiliation of the native population.

“We shall reduce the Arab population to a community of woodcutters and waiters”—Uri Lubrani, PM Ben-Gurion’s special adviser on Arab Affairs, 1960.

“When we have settled the land, all the Arabs will be able to do about it will be to scurry around like drugged cockroaches in a bottle.”—Raphael Eitan, Chief of Staff of the Israeli Defence Forces, New York Times, 14 April 1983.

“We have to kill all the Palestinians unless they are resigned to live here as slaves.”  Chairman Heilbrun of the Committee for the Re-election of General Shlomo Lahat, the mayor of Tel Aviv, October 1983.

"[The Palestinians] would be crushed like grasshoppers … heads smashed against the boulders and walls."—Yitzhak Shamir in 1988: 2. Calls to Make Life Miserable to Cause “Voluntary Migration”

Joseph Weitz, 1940: "​We must do everything to ensure they never return... not one village, not one tribe must be left."​

Rehavam Ze’evi, 2001: "​We must encourage them to leave. We must make life so difficult for them that they will want to leave."​

Moshe Feiglin, 2014: "​We must encourage emigration from Gaza. We must make it clear that there is no future for them here."​

Bezalel Smotrich, 2023: "​We should offer emigration packages to Palestinians in Gaza. It's the humane solution."​

Moshe Feiglin 2014: “Gaza is part of Israel, and should remain as such forever...that strip of land should become part of sovereign Israel to be populated by Jews...Israel should invest a lot of money...so in 10-15 years the Arab population in Gaza will be much smaller.”

in this thread, I present a brief exchange, which I feel illuminates the nature of Israel's "left."

it began with a mass mailing to a group from @gershonbaskin (I'm not sure how I got on this list in the first place).

the email was entitled "How Palestinians can help end the war in Gaza." the text of how Palestinians are supposed to end the genocide being committed against them follows: "It is very clear that the Palestinians want an immediate end to the war in Gaza and it is essential that it ends now. The main contribution that the Palestinians can make to speed up the end of the war is to ensure that Hamas will not be ruling Gaza when the war is over. To my understanding, this can only happen with the establishment of a civilian, professional, technocrat government, headed by someone appointed by Mahmoud Abbas, but independent from Abbas. The continuation of the Fatah-Hamas unity talks which were recently held in Cairo is a waste of time because Hamas rejects a government controlled by Fatah as much as Fatah rejects a government head by Hamas. There are only a couple of Palestinian individuals who have the ability and the legitimacy to form a Palestinian government in Gaza which would be independent, clean, and aspires for peace with Israel based on two states established on the basis of the June 4, 1967 lines and is committed to bringing about the end of the occupation without the use of violence. Furthermore, the individuals that could head the government of Gaza that I know,  recognize that the Gaza government is temporary for as long is necessary (24-36 months) to create enough stability to conduct democratic elections for a unified Palestinian government with territorial integrity of the West Bank, East Jerusalem and Gaza.  A primary condition for Israel to end the war, and that would generate the political force in Israel to demand that Israel withdraws from all of Gaza begins with Hamas not ruling Gaza after the war.  Releasing all of the hostages is another Israeli condition for ending the war. These things must be done in order for this horrific war to finally end. The Palestinians themselves can move forward on the Gaza governance issue without any negotiations with Israel.  This is entirely a Palestinian issue, and if they do it well, they will gain the support of the entire world which is absolutely necessary for the reconstruction of Gaza. (Gershon Baskin, November 19, 2024)
